Zack and Quack

Synopsis:
Zack and Quack is an animated series that follows the adventures of a young boy named Zack and his best friend, an energetic duck named Quack. Together, they live in a pop-up book world where every page turn brings a new adventure. Zack and Quack are joined by their friends, including Kira, a creative hedgehog, and Belly-Up, a wise bullfrog. Each episode features the group exploring their vibrant, interactive world, solving problems, and embarking on exciting quests. The pop-up book setting allows for imaginative scenarios, with Zack and Quack using their creativity to navigate challenges and discover new places. The show is filled with colorful visuals and engaging storylines, making it a delightful experience for young viewers.

Parental Feedback
Zack and Quack is an animated adventure TV show for kids that aired from 2012 to 2017. It is known for its imaginative and creative storytelling, set in a pop-up book world that captivates young audiences. The general tone is light-hearted and educational, with most parents appreciating its ability to engage children while promoting problem-solving and teamwork.
